Epigenetic instability caused by absence of CIZ1 drives transformation during quiescence cycles.

Olivia G DobbsRosemary H C WilsonKatherine NewlingJustin F-X AinscoughDawn Coverley
Published in: BMC biology (2023)
Our results demonstrate a role for CIZ1 in chromatin condensation on entry to quiescence and explore the consequences of this defect in CIZ1-null cells. Together, the data show that CIZ1's protection of the epigenome guards against genome instability during quiescence cycles. This identifies loss of CIZ1 as a potentially devastating vulnerability in cells that undergo cycles of quiescence entry and exit.
